I had this same problem also and found the solution on these forums somewhere after lots of searching. I wanted to use the 1920x1200 resolution. Go into the folder with keyclone, and open the Keyclone.ini file. This may also show up as the configuration settings under type. Find the region and set up these settings as below. After you do that and save I think you have to click on the file again and make it read only. I think thats what I did.
region_00=1,0,0,1920,1200,0,0

i use twin Dell 240X series ( one 2407 and one 2408 ) which both get 1920x1200, which is super nice b/c i can have my main on the center monitor and 4x 960x600 windows for the 4 slave toons on the right monitor.
I used to have just one 1920x1200 24" and a Samsung 210B (1280x1024) and that was ok, but the windows were ~1/2 the size i'm rolling now and made reading any kind of text in the slave windows pretty much impossible.
If its possible budget wise, i would suggest at least 1 24" with a 1920x1200 resolution, for slaves if nothing else since you can set them up with alternate camera views (i use my slave windows to scout my peripheral vision and top-down (zoomed out) to see if someone is sneaking up behind me while i'm traveling.

I'm using a DoubleSight 26" LCD here. I edited the config.wtf and set the resolution where I wanted it. I've tried it at 1920x1200 (native resolution) and it worked great. I'm sitting at about 1400x1108 or something now, so I can run the smaller 2nd wow for my priest alongside it.
